Answer / vivek gulhare
As per American
Society of Mechanical Engineers
(ASME) the specific ratio - the
ratio of the discharge pressure
over the suction pressure – is
used for defining the fans,
blowers and compressors
Fans - Up to 1.11
Blowers- 1.11 to 1.20
Compressors - more than 1.20

Answer / chaitanya pithawa
fan is just used for air moving.Its blade are axailly bladed.
fans usually move large volumes of air at low pressure.
blower is a centrifugal fan,blower is a machine for moving
volumes of a gas with moderate increase of pressure.
